Steve is a researcher at IBM Almaden Research. His research interests range from social & collaboration software to web data mining. His current and past projects include:
- Work Marketplace - crowdsourcing meets enterprise
- Social Analytics - combining social software with machine learning
- Contact Central - cross-application social address book
- Team Analytics - visualizations of a group of people
- Bluemail - web 2.0 platform for email research
- Fringe - automatically generated profiles and social network for the enterprise
- WebFountain - full-scale web crawl and text analytics, to find business value from the web
- Grand Central Station - web crawler and platform for text analytics
